SAW was  found on June 25, 2000, to support displaced girls and young women from Myanmar who fled to Mae Sot, Tak Province, Thailand due to crisis and conflict. SAW’s mission is to empower and protect vulnerable girls, women, children, and migrants affected by political instability along the Thai–Myanmar border.
